About this role

Nerdio simplifies IT operations and helps organizations deploy, manage, and optimize Microsoft cloud and end-user computing technologies. The Solutions Engineer will build AI-powered tools, automations, internal applications, integrations, and prototypes while working across full-stack development, Azure, DevOps, data analytics, and internal business systems.

What you'll do:

  • Work with the team to turn real business problems across Nerdio into prototypes, automations, and internal applications
  • Experiment with new AI models, APIs, frameworks, SDKs, and developer tools
  • Build proofs of concept quickly, gather feedback, and help determine which ideas are worth continuing
  • Learn how to move successful prototypes toward secure, maintainable production systems
  • Contribute ideas for new tools and automations based on problems you observe across the company
  • Build AI-powered workflows, agents, and internal tools with guidance from more experienced engineers
  • Work with technologies such as tool/function calling, MCP, APIs, structured outputs, retrieval, agent orchestration, and LLM-driven automation
  • Integrate AI systems with internal business platforms and data sources
  • Test AI behavior, investigate failure modes, and improve reliability
  • Learn and apply the team's patterns for building AI systems safely and responsibly
  • Build and maintain features across internal web applications
  • Work with technologies such as TypeScript, JavaScript, Node.js, React or similar frontend frameworks, and PostgreSQL

What they're looking for:

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Engineering, Cybersecurity, Data Science, or a related technical field, or equivalent hands-on technical experience
  • Demonstrated ability to build software through coursework, internships, personal projects, open-source contributions, employment, or similar experience
  • Working knowledge of at least one modern programming language. Experience with JavaScript or TypeScript is especially useful
  • Basic understanding of APIs, databases, web applications, and software development fundamentals
  • Familiarity with Git and source control concepts
  • Experience using modern AI tools for technical work, or a strong interest in learning AI-assisted software development
  • Ability to read code, reason about what it is doing, and troubleshoot problems
  • Strong curiosity and willingness to learn unfamiliar technologies
  • Ability to communicate technical ideas clearly and work collaboratively with others
  • Comfortable taking feedback, asking questions, and iterating quickly
  • This role is limited to US Persons or those with valid work authorization that does not require sponsorship
  • Internship, coursework, or project experience building web applications
